Instructions
Melt butter in a large saucepan. Stir in flour until smooth. Gradually add broth. Bring to a boil; cook and stir for 2 minutes or until thickened. Stir in coriander and half of the chilies. In a large bowl, combine the chicken, Monterey Jack cheese and remaining chilies.
Spoon 1/3 cup chicken mixture onto each tortilla; roll up.
Place seam side down in an ungreased 13-in. x 9-in. baking dish.
Pour sauce over enchiladas.
Sprinkle with cheddar cheese.
Bake, uncovered, at 375° for 15-18 minutes or until heated through and cheese is melted.
